Ingredients & Substitutions

Cucumbers: I love using English cucumbers for their thin skin and fewer seeds. If you can’t find them, regular cucumbers work too—just peel them if the skin is too thick.

Tomatoes: Ripe vine tomatoes add great flavor. If you’re in a pinch, cherry tomatoes can be a sweet alternative. Just halve them instead of dicing.

Red Onion: Red onion gives a nice crunch and color, but if it’s too sharp for your taste, you could swap it for green onions or even sweet Vidalia onions for a milder flavor.

Kalamata Olives: These olives have a rich flavor, but black olives or green olives can be used if you prefer something different.

Feta Cheese: For a creamier texture, try using goat cheese instead. Crumbled cotage cheese can also be a lighter option.

How Can I Make Sure My Salad Is Extra Flavorful?

To boost the flavor of your salad, don’t skip the resting step! Letting the salad sit for about 10 minutes after mixing allows the veggies to soak up the dressing. This makes a big difference! Here’s how:

  • Mix veggies first, then add the feta and olives last to keep them intact.
  • Whisk your dressing well to ensure every drop is flavored.
  • Taste after resting! You may want to adjust the seasoning with more salt or pepper.

Using fresh herbs like parsley is key; chopping them just before adding releases their oils and enhances the aroma. Enjoy your salad prep!

Fresh and Easy Greek Cucumber Salad

Ingredients You’ll Need:

For the Salad:

  • 2 large cucumbers, peeled and diced
  • 2 medium tomatoes, diced
  • 1/2 red onion, thinly sliced
  • 1/2 cup Kalamata olives, pitted and halved
  • 1/2 cup feta cheese, crumbled
  • 1/4 cup fresh parsley, chopped

For the Dressing:

  • 2 tablespoons extra-virgin olive oil
  • 1 tablespoon red wine vinegar
  • 1 teaspoon dried oregano
  • Salt and freshly ground black pepper, to taste

How Much Time Will You Need?

This delicious salad takes about 15 minutes to prepare. You’ll have a fresh and vibrant dish ready to serve in no time! Let it sit for about 10 minutes to let the flavors meld before digging in.

Step-by-Step Instructions:

1. Combine the Veggies:

In a large bowl, toss together the diced cucumbers, diced tomatoes, sliced red onion, and halved Kalamata olives. This forms the base of your fresh salad!

2. Add Feta and Herbs:

Next, sprinkle the crumbled feta cheese and chopped parsley over the vegetable mixture. This will add a nice creaminess and herbal flavor to your salad.

3. Mix the Dressing:

In a separate small bowl, whisk together the extra-virgin olive oil, red wine vinegar, dried oregano, salt, and black pepper. Make sure it’s well combined to ensure every bite has great flavor.

4. Combine Everything:

Pour the dressing over the salad and toss everything gently to mix. You want to coat the vegetables without breaking them apart.

5. Let It Rest:

Set the salad aside for about 10 minutes. This resting time allows the flavors to blend beautifully, enhancing the overall taste.

6. Serve and Enjoy:

Serve the salad chilled or at room temperature. It’s perfect as a side dish or light lunch. Enjoy every crunchy, flavorful bite of your fresh Greek cucumber salad!

FAQ for Fresh and Easy Greek Cucumber Salad

Can I Use Different Vegetables in This Salad?

Absolutely! Feel free to add or substitute with vegetables you prefer, such as bell peppers, radishes, or even avocado for creaminess. Just keep the overall proportion similar for the best texture and flavor.

How Long Does This Salad Last in the Fridge?

This salad is best enjoyed fresh but can be stored in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 2 days. Keep in mind that the cucumbers may release some water, so give it a good stir before serving again!

What Can I Substitute for Feta Cheese?

If you’re not a fan of feta, you can try goat cheese or even crumbled Ricotta for a different flavor. For a dairy-free option, use a vegan feta or omit cheese altogether without compromising the salad’s freshness!

Can I Prep This Salad in Advance?

You can make this salad a few hours ahead of time. Just assemble all the ingredients, but wait until right before serving to add the dressing. This keeps the cucumbers crisp and prevents them from getting soggy.
